impl<L, A, R> NetworkBuilder<L, (A, R)>
where
L: HList + Selector<adnl::Deferred, A>,
HCons<Deferred, L>: IntoTuple2,
{
/// Creates DHT network layer
///
/// # Examples
///
/// ```
/// # use std::error::Error;
/// # use anyhow::Result;
/// # use everscale_network::{adnl, dht, NetworkBuilder};
///
/// #[tokio::main]
/// async fn main() -> Result<()> {
/// const DHT_KEY_TAG: usize = 0;
///
/// let keystore = adnl::Keystore::builder()
/// .with_tagged_key([0; 32], DHT_KEY_TAG)?
/// .build();
///
/// let adnl_options = adnl::NodeOptions::default();
/// let dht_options = dht::NodeOptions::default();
///
/// let (adnl, dht) = NetworkBuilder::with_adnl("127.0.0.1:10000", keystore, adnl_options)
/// .with_dht(DHT_KEY_TAG, dht_options)
/// .build()?;
/// Ok(())
/// }
/// ```
#[allow(clippy::type_complexity)]
pub fn with_dht(
self,
key_tag: usize,
options: NodeOptions,
) -> NetworkBuilder<HCons<Deferred, L>, (There<A>, There<R>)> {
let deferred = match self.0.get() {
Ok(adnl) => Ok((adnl.clone(), key_tag, options)),
Err(_) => Err(anyhow::anyhow!("ADNL was not initialized")),
};
NetworkBuilder(self.0.prepend(deferred), Default::default())
}
}
/// DHT key name used for storing nodes socket address
pub const KEY_ADDRESS: &str = "address";
/// DHT key name used for storing overlay nodes
pub const KEY_NODES: &str = "nodes";
/// Max allowed DHT peers in the network
pub const MAX_DHT_PEERS: u32 = 65536;
